Deliveries to the University Archives

All paper documents to be preserved will sooner or later be delivered to the University Archives’ storage facility at Arkivcentrum Syd for final archiving. To be accepted, documents must be organised and accompanied by an inventory. Deliveries that have not first been registered will not be accepted. Proton-transfer dynamics plays a critical role in many biochemical processes, such as proton pumping across membranes and enzyme catalysis. The large majority of enzymes utilize acid-base catalysis and proton-transfer mechanisms, where the rates of proton transfer can be rate limiting for the overall reaction. Measurement of cortisol concentration can contribute important information about an individual's ability to adjust to various environmental demands of both physical and psychosocial origin. However, one uncertainty that affects the possibilities of correctly interpreting and designing field studies is the lack of observations of the impact of seasonal changes on cortisol excretion.
